A stage designed for families
The Théâtre Forum Meyrin is one of the major stages in the canton of Geneva. Over the season, you can discover around thirty shows from here and elsewhere, and a good share of this programme is aimed at young audiences. Theatre, dance, circus, music or puppets: there is something for the little ones as well as the older ones, in a warm, well-equipped hall of about 700 seats.

Before you go
- Recommended age: from age 6 for most family shows, some accessible from age 4. Check the recommended age listed for each show.
- Duration: generally 45 minutes to 1 hour depending on the performance.
- Booking: strongly recommended, as shows for young audiences often sell out. Book on the official website or at the box office.
- Stroller accessibility: step-free access through automatic sliding doors; foyer, bars and toilets accessible on the ground floor.
- Transport: by TPG tram (lines 14 and 18) to Meyrin, with a stop right next to the Forum. By car, the Feuillasse car park right next door.
- What to bring: arrive a little early to settle in without stress; remember to ask the recommended age of the show when booking.
- Best season: all year round, an ideal indoor outing in grey or cold weather.
Parents' tips
- Choose a show that really matches your child's age: the age guidance is not a detail, it greatly changes the experience.
- For a first time at the theatre, favour a short (45 min) and visual form (circus, dance, puppets).
- Book early: family performances on Wednesdays and weekends go quickly.
- Explain before the outing what is going to happen (the darkness, the silence, the applause) to put the youngest at ease.
